It seams the issue has been fixed in 2.1.0, I checked the code. The problem was occuring when params where null and MessageFormat was expecting params. The fix is the following:
if (params.length == 0)
{
builder.append(expr.toString());
}
else
{
String value = new MessageFormat(expr.toString(), Locale.instance()).format(params);
builder.append(value);
}
In 2.0.3CR1 the test on params.length was not there... try to use MessageFormat with a choice and a params length to 0 and you will see.
So we can say it is fixed.

> In my properties file:
> my.choice.message = {0,choice,0#No choice|1# 1 choice|1< {0,number,integer} choices}
> This is working with MessageFormat but Interpolator returns only {0} and my choices are lost.
> After checking the code the problem is coming from the #.
